Plan B (2009 film)
Plan B is a 2009 Argentine thriller film directed by Marco Berger. The film explores themes of friendship, sexuality, and identity.
Synopsis:
Bruno, after being dumped by his girlfriend, begins to spend time with her new boyfriend, Pablo. Initially, Bruno intends to sabotage the relationship between his ex and Pablo. However, as he spends more time with Pablo, Bruno begins to develop unexpected feelings for him. The film follows Bruno's internal conflict as he grapples with his changing desires and the consequences of his actions.

Reception:
Plan B received mixed to positive reviews. Some critics praised its nuanced portrayal of evolving relationships and its subtle approach to exploring themes of sexual identity. Others found the pacing slow and the plot somewhat predictable. The film was recognized for its performances, particularly by Vignau and Ferraro.
